Buyer’s Guide: How to Pick a Cat Tree for the Window

  • Low or Narrow Base: A slim or compact footprint lets the tree fit flush against your window, making the most of your sunniest spot.
  • Tall Perch Height: Choose a tree with a high perch or platform level with the window sill for the best view.
  • Sturdy Design: Wide, stable bases or wall anchors keep the tree steady—especially for active cats who leap and climb.
  • Plush, Easy-to-Clean Beds: Soft, sun-warmed beds are irresistible, and removable covers make cleanup easy.
  • Easy Access: Steps or ramps are helpful for senior cats, and wide platforms make it simple for any cat to climb up to the sunniest spot.
  • Stylish Look: Modern, minimal styles help the tree blend in near your windows and fit your décor.

FAQ: Cat Trees for Window Watching

How tall should a cat tree be for a window?

Choose a tree with a perch at or above your window sill—usually 24 to 36 inches tall for most windows.

Can I use a cat tree with a suction-cup window perch?

Yes, many window cat trees pair perfectly with suction-cup perches for even more sunbathing spots.

Are cat trees safe for window use?

Always choose a tree with a stable, wide base and place it on a flat surface. Wall anchors are a bonus for extra wiggly climbers.

What if my cat is a senior or has mobility issues?

Pick a tree with steps or ramps, and lower perches to make climbing easy for every age and ability.
